Swiss InterRail Group introduces successful reefer container transports across Europe-Asia route

The Swiss InterRail Group achieved a milestone last year with the successful execution of its inaugural reefer container transports between Asia and Europe. In a strategic expansion for the current year, the transportation company has now incorporated temperature-controlled rail transport into its regular service offerings.

Utilizing advanced diesel-powered 45-foot pallet wide reefer containers on the Europe-Asia route, InterRail ensures independent cooling or heating capabilities across different modes of transport. Continuous monitoring of container performance and internal temperature, coupled with daily detailed reports, provides customers with comprehensive information about their goods. With a capacity of up to 33 euro-pallets per refrigerated container, optimal air circulation is maintained. Temperature-controlled rail transport offers numerous advantages, including faster delivery compared to sea transport, cost-effectiveness in comparison to air freight, and the elimination of goods transshipment along the route.

One noteworthy instance of success occurred in late summer when InterRail transported 13.5 tonnes of premium Swiss chocolate from Basel to Shanghai. Operating at a set point of 12°C, the reefer container proved its reliability even under extreme outside temperatures reaching up to 42°C. Another testament to its effectiveness was demonstrated in the transportation of miso ramen soups from Shanghai to Hamburg, where the reefer container safeguarded the goods at a set point of 10 °C amidst a lowest outside temperature of -27 °C.
